Can you see the bubbles? I think it's because the owner has put the card in a screwdown protector inside a penny sleeve... they weren't designed to hold both, so there's not enough room... and cards can be damaged this way... so just be careful folks.
Roz, I think you're right in what the owner did with the card.  You CAN in fact use a penny sleeve (or slip sleeve - whatever you want to call it) with a snap tite holder, but it's an effort to get it to fit well.  So much easier to leave the card loose inside the hard card holder (snap tite or screwdown or magnet holder).  I only use penny sleeves with top loaders.
